Pursuant to Texas Government Code, §2161.062(e), state agencies with biennial budgets that exceed $10 million shall designate a staff member to serve as the Historically Underutilized Businesses (HUB) Coordinator for the agency. The Coordinator will advise and assist agency executive directors and staff in complying with VetHUB requirements, facilitating the agency’s good faith effort to increase VetHUB participation, preparing and submitting VetHUB reports, monitoring contracts for VetHUB compliance and coordinating VetHUB marketing and outreach efforts.
Agency Coordinator Contact List (CSV)
It is the responsibility of each state agency to provide the Statewide Procurement Division (SPD) with the name, phone number, fax number and email address of its designated HUB Coordinator.
